:::

9-2 讓資料庫可以讓別的主機連線

  1. 若想讓主機的資料庫也開放給其他機器連線
  2. 先在防火牆加入設定
    vi /etc/rc.local
  3. 加入3306 port 的設定,例如:

    $IPTABLES -A INPUT -p tcp -s 120.115.2.0/24 --dport 3306 -j ACCEPT
    $IPTABLES -A INPUT -p tcp -s 120.115.3.0/24 --dport 3306 -j ACCEPT
    $IPTABLES -A INPUT -p tcp -s 127.0.0.1 --dport 3306 -j ACCEPT
    $IPTABLES -A INPUT -p tcp --dport 3306 -j DROP
  4. 重新套用防火牆
    /etc/rc.local
  5. 解除資料庫IP綁訂
    vi /etc/mysql/mariadb.conf.d/50-server.cnf
  6. 將裡面的bind-address標記起來

    #bind-address           = 127.0.0.1
    
  7. 重啟資料庫即可

    service mysql restart
  8. 接著就是在資料庫開權限即可。

:::

書籍目錄

展開 | 闔起

http%3A%2F%2Fcampus-xoops.tn.edu.tw%2Fmodules%2Ftad_book3%2Fpage.php%3Ftbdsn%3D992

計數器

今天: 1066106610661066
昨天: 1659165916591659
總計: 3470352347035234703523470352347035234703523470352